is applicable to integrate short stories and poems in the reading class The experiment  Setting:  English Department of HPU  Participants:  40 students of 2nd year  Language level: uper-intermediate  Time:  At the beginning of 2nd term  13 weeks Methodology  Quantitative research method   Questionnaires:     Easy and time saving Meet the aims of the study Economical and suitable with the situation in HPU Description:   Aims at measuring a hypothesis Two questionnaires:  Attitude of students toward literary texts  Effects of using short stories and poems in teaching and learning reading Method of collecting data:  At the end of term, weeks before the final exam Results and Findings  Results:  Pointed out that integrating short stories and poems in reading class makes the lesson more enjoyable and helps enhance students’ reading skills Most students like short stories and poems than novel and drama  75% of students found short stories and poems interesting and help promote their creativity  64% of students agreed that reading short stories and poems makes them feel eager to answer comprehension questions  Results and Findings Majority of students think that they can learn new words and remember them longer in the context of a short story  75% students are interested in interpreting the characters of the story or the figurative language in the poem  All students like working with activities in post-reading phase(eg: turn the poem into a pop song, writing a new ending of a short story,etc.)  All students had positive reaction after reading short stories and poems and agreed that these literary texts enhanced their reading skills  Many suggestions are given to make the lesson more effective  Results and Findings   It is advisable to integrate literary texts in the language classroom  Students’ reading skills can be developed through the reading of short stories and poems 10 Recommendation Introduced techniques to integrate short stories and poems in teaching reading Selecting and evaluating the texts Anticipating students’ problems Suggested activities to use with short stories and poems in reading classes Giving some keys using literary texts in reading classes 11 Limitation and Suggestion for further research  Limitation  Only one semester doing the experiment  Only 40 participants and no teacher  Inexperienced  Suggestion for further research  Using literature at lower level  Using literature with mixed ability language classes  Literature in the teaching of listening,
